Poly(vinyl alcohol) CAS#9002-89-5

Poly(vinyl alcohol) (PVA) is a water-soluble synthetic polymer derived from the hydrolysis of poly(vinyl acetate). It is renowned for its film-forming properties, biocompatibility, and high tensile strength. PVA is extensively used in the production of textiles, paper, and adhesives due to its excellent adhesive and emulsifying characteristics. Its water solubility and biodegradability make it a preferred material in various industrial applications, including packaging films and medical devices.

Poly(vinyl alcohol) Chemical Properties
Melting point >300???C
Boiling point -14.5??C (rough estimate)
density 1.080 g/cm3
Tg 73
Tg 99
Tg 99??C
refractive index 1.3810 (estimate)
Fp 79??C
storage temp. Store below +30??C.
solubility H2O: soluble (hot)
form Powder
color White to cream
Odor at 100.00?%. odorless
PH 3.5-7.0 (40g/l, H2O, 20??)
Water Solubility soluble in hot water
Merck 14,7585
Dielectric constant 1.9??Ambient??
Stability: Stable. Combustible. Dust may form explosive mixtures with air. Incompatible with strong oxidizing agents.
